Beechgrove Garden
Season 47 Episode 4: Episode 4
Gardening for wildlife, vegetables and small spaces are all covered in this episode. Brian plants shrubs in the garden for wildlife, choosing varieties that will encourage and help pollinators. Ruth starts her own vegetable plot that she will use as her entry in this year’s presenter veg-growing competition. She also starts her vertical garden, ideal for anyone with just a small space in which to grow. Ruth also tackles this year’s tomatoes in the 6x8 greenhouse, and she tests an automatic irrigation system that could be a great idea if you have to leave your precious plants to go on holiday this summer.
